summaryrefslogtreecommitdiffstats
path: root/Tests
diff options
context:
space:
mode:
authorRobert Maynard <rmaynard@nvidia.com>2024-10-17 18:45:57 (GMT)
committerBrad King <brad.king@kitware.com>2024-10-18 00:18:24 (GMT)
commitee9e2216ecb0173ff20411a2347df2d207b6d9ca (patch)
tree5780f9ac9e927eae0575c1e36b939d6fcc915d22 /Tests
parentcb981c3b0074d8f2568ed935726eeada7ed2d07f (diff)
downloadCMake-ee9e2216ecb0173ff20411a2347df2d207b6d9ca.zip
CMake-ee9e2216ecb0173ff20411a2347df2d207b6d9ca.tar.gz
CMake-ee9e2216ecb0173ff20411a2347df2d207b6d9ca.tar.bz2
Tests: Simplify CUDA kernels avoid crash with nvidia driver 550
Avoid having two identical kernels in PTX. We don't need a second kernel anyway.
Diffstat (limited to 'Tests')
-rw-r--r--Tests/CudaOnly/SeparateCompilationPTX/kernels.cu7
1 files changed, 0 insertions, 7 deletions
diff --git a/Tests/CudaOnly/SeparateCompilationPTX/kernels.cu b/Tests/CudaOnly/SeparateCompilationPTX/kernels.cu
index f4a52d4..fbe0d26 100644
--- a/Tests/CudaOnly/SeparateCompilationPTX/kernels.cu
+++ b/Tests/CudaOnly/SeparateCompilationPTX/kernels.cu
@@ -5,10 +5,3 @@ __global__ void kernelA(float* r, float* x, float* y, float* z, int size)
r[i] = x[i] * y[i] + z[i];
}
}
-
-__global__ void kernelB(float* r, float* x, float* y, float* z, int size)
-{
- for (int i = threadIdx.x; i < size; i += blockDim.x) {
- r[i] = x[i] * y[i] + z[i];
- }
-}